Tranny and diff. leak.

A few months back I installed 4.56 gears and I really like the result. My only concern was vibration (bad vibration) at around 80 mph and above and when I was coasting at about 60 mhp down to 40 mph. Some say I need to get the driveline balanced. Wouldn't the vibration happen at a certain rpm and not a certain mph? I don't know for sure but it kinda makes sense to me. On top of that I was driving down the freeway today and I noticed smoke coming from my truck. It turned out that the tranny was leaking fluid from where the driveline comes into it because the seal was working itself out and the fluid was leaking on top of the exhaust causing it to smoke. When I got home I got under the truck and noticed that there was fluid sprayed or flung all over the under carriage around the rear differential too but I couldn't detect where a leak that could cause that was coming from. Can anyone help?

You probably need to replace the rear seal on the tranny and the front seal on the pumpkin. The vibration issue I'm not so sure about. A number of things could cause that but in your case ujoints?
